Coffee is facing a defining moment. Climate change, environmental degradation and growing pressure across the value chain are creating unprecedented risks for the future of our industry. 

Addressing these challenges will require collaboration and action from every corner of the coffee community. So in this episode, we’re exploring what sustainability really means for coffee and what needs to change to secure the future of the industry.

We'll hear from Vanúsia Nogueira, International Coffee Organization, Violeta Stevens, Union Hand-Roasted Coffee, Kasper Hülsen and Sebastian Nielsen, Slow Forest, Konrad Brits, Falcon Coffees, Cemal Ezel, Change Please.

While the challenges are significant, there is also a huge opportunity for coffee to lead the way in creating a more sustainable and resilient future for our planet. What is 5THWAVE - The Business of Coffee and Hospitality?

A forward-thinking interview series examining the business of progressive coffee culture.

The 5THWAVE Podcast is hosted by Jeffrey Young, Editor-in-Chief of 5THWAVE magazine and Founder of Allegra Group.

Each episode features inspiring stories, business lessons, and thought leadership from the entrepreneurs and industry experts blazing trails to success across the world of coffee.

The podcast will delve into the detail of achieving operational excellence, get to grips with green coffee sourcing and seek out the very best of global coffee culture. We’ll also examine the future of e-commerce and coffee at home, the changing face of cafés and coffee shops, and how to hone winning HR strategies – plus much more.
